Brescia Draws Livorno 2-2 in Promotion Playoff

Letters From Vagabondia 15 June @ 07:52 PM EST
American midfielder Danny Szetela did not play in Brescia's 2-2 draw with Livorno yesterday, the first leg in a home-and-away series to determine who will play in Serie A next year.
Given that the away goals rule does not apply and the higher seeded team (Livorno) advances if the goal aggregate is tied, Brescia faces a must-win situation on the road next week at Livorno. Click to continue reading...

Szetela, Brescia On The Brink

Letters From Vagabondia 13 June @ 10:13 AM EST
American midfielder Danny Szetela and his Brescia teammates have a chance to earn promotion to Serie A if they can get past Livorno in a home and away playoff.
The first leg will be played tomorrow on June 14 in Brescia with the return leg on June 20 in Livorno. In the Italian playoff scheme, away goals do not apply so if tied on aggregate goals, the higher seeded team (Livorno) is be promoted. Click to continue reading...

Mannini and Possanzini suspension terminated

The Offside: Italy 18 March @ 04:16 PM EST

Remember the whole fiasco a couple of months back when Brescia striker Davide Possanzini and Napoli winger Daniele Mannini were suspended for a year for showing up 15 minutes late to post-match drug testing? Well, they both can breathe huge sighs of relief as today TAS suspended the decision, allowing Mannini and Possanzini to get back on the football pitches.

Bernardo Stays At Napoli But European Interest Remains

Letters From Vagabondia 07 February @ 03:32 PM EST
It looks like American forward Vincenzo Bernardo will be staying with SSC Napoli this spring after turning down several offers from throughout Europe. Bernardo had drawn interest from Spain, England, Romania, Belgium, Greece, and among several Italian Serie B and C teams. The strongest offer came from Serie B side Brescia which offered to buy joint ownership (50-50) of the New Jersey player - an offer Napoli refused. Click to continue reading...

Missing Five Starters, Brescia Tops Frosinone

Letters From Vagabondia 04 October @ 10:59 AM EST
Playing without a slightly injured Danny Szetela along with four other starters, Brescia topped a feisty Frosinone side 2-1 this afternoon in a rainy Serie B matchup. Brescia defender Marco Gorzengo seems to have recovered well from a calf injury, scoring both Brescia goals to put them at 13 points and fifth place in the league, within striking distance of a promotion spot (for now).
